Video Enhanced Flame Detection (VEFD™)

 

The FlameSpec™ Blade detector combines the superior detection, stability, and reliability of the market-leading FlameSpecTM IR3 flame detector with the latest AI advances in video flame imaging to deliver a new standard in flame detection.

The combination delivers extremely fast detection of visible hydrocarbon fires, with near-total immunity to false alarms, including to those caused by flare reflections.

Considering the costs for a shutdown due to a false alarm on an FPSO might typically range from $500,000 to $5 million, it's clear that alarms due to reflected flares are financially damaging.

Key Benefits

  • Highest immunity to false alarms and high immunity to reflected flares - FM certified.

  • Video Enhanced Flame Detection (VEFD™). Visible hydrocarbon flame detection using three clearly separated IR wavelengths (4.0–5.0 μm), combined with near-IR imaging for superior performance.

  • Each sensor has the same field of view to further improve false alarm immunity.

  • HD, or composite, video output with automatic HD video recording of fire events.

  • Fast flame detection, typically less than 5 seconds.

  • Detects up to 147 ft (45 m) for a 1 ft2 (0.1 m2) n-heptane fire.

  • 5 selectable sensitivity levels.

  • 3- and 4- wire, 0—20 mA sink / source, Alarm, Auxilary, and Fault Relays.

  • RS485 port using Modbus RTU.

  • Event logger: Alarms, faults & videos are logged to non-volatile memory for post-event analysis and investigation.

  • Built-in-Test (BIT) – Automatic and manual self-test of window cleanliness and overall detector operation, plus HART® 7, for configuration and maintenance.

  • Dirty optics warning for preventive maintenance needs.

  • Window heater to avoid condensation and icing.

  • Stainless steel tilt mount with horizontal and vertical adjustment.
